Tifereth Israel’s weekday morning Shacharit service is held Monday through Friday at 7:30 a.m. and on Sundays, weekday Yom Tov, and secular holidays at 8:30 a.m. in the Goodman Chapel.

Tifereth Israel has the honor of being the only Conservative shul in San Diego that maintains a consistent daily morning minyan (the minimum of ten Jewish adults required for a full public worship service). We are continuing a tradition that dates back to our earliest years as a congregation.

Mr. I. Frank… has returned to again take up his position as one of the ‘hustlers’ for the congregation. Mr. Frank has been one of the most active workers from the start and has not relaxed his interest — it will have to be below zero in San Diego when Bro. Frank does not succeed in making up a ‘minyan,’ as he tells every man he is the last one needed.

From B’nai B’rith Messenger, June 15, 1906 as quoted in
Tifereth Israel Synagogue: 100 Years Honoring Yesterday, Building Tomorrow.

Our minyan is egalitarian and welcoming. Membership in Tifereth Israel Synagogue is not required to attend. All are welcome, especially those in the community wishing to say Kaddish for the Yahrzeit of a loved one. Torah readers are encouraged to join us and read Torah on Mondays, Thursdays, and Yom Tov.

A complimentary bagel breakfast follows each morning Minyan in the Cohen Social Hall.
